DEVISER is a Sci-Fi Horror Audio Drama, created by Harlan Guthrie. In this series Son wakes up aboard a spaceship bound for earth in an effort to recolonize. What he discovers however will change everything he knows about his world and himself.
All episodes of DEVISER are available now.

    Another Fun Ride by Harlan Guthrie
    Came here from Malevolent. Sound design is incredible and Harlan definitely knows his stuff when it comes to audio as a method of telling a story. I can see why some people aren't fond of this particular story, but to me it comes across as a bit of a different spin on something like I Have No Mouth But I Must Scream - if something like A.M. "loved" humanity instead of possessing hatred, but there's still a sense of dread and hopelessness present. I'm unsure if that was the intention but it is how it registers in my head. If it were a bit longer of a series I'd be more critical of the pacing and some of the other writing decisions but I assume that creating a more full-fledged story is difficult when one it's a one-man show and the one man behind said show has other productions and projects going on. For that reason, Deviser is a short, entertaining romp and I think it deserves five stars for what it is. EDIT: I completely skipped out on the "AI-generated human" theme here snd how that's relevant to modern day technological developments and that has me viewing this story through a completely different lens - in a positive way! Definitely love the concept of bringing to life the disturbing imagery that "AI art" produces when it comes to the human form and turning that into a body horror-focused podcast. This podcast is about many things but it is definitely about AI's inability to fully understand the human condition.
